Understanding How Same Day Loans Work in Walters A same day payday loan is a small, short-term loan designed to be repaid by your next paycheck. The key appeal is speed; if you apply and are approved early in the day, funds can often be deposited into your bank account before the day ends. In Walters, you might find options through local storefront lenders or online providers that serve Oklahoma. It's crucial to understand the terms, which are regulated by Oklahoma state law. Oklahoma sets limits on these loans, but the costs can still be high, so they should be used for genuine emergencies, not for non-essential spending. Always verify that any lender you consider is licensed to operate in Oklahoma.
Local Tips and Responsible Borrowing for Walters Residents Before you apply, take a moment to explore all options. Could a payment plan with the doctor in Walters or the auto shop on Main Street be arranged? Have you checked with local community resources or family? If a payday loan is your best path, borrow only the absolute minimum you need. For example, if your car needs a $300 repair to get you to work at the peanut mill or school, don't borrow $500. Carefully review the loan agreement, paying close attention to the finance charge and the due date. Mark your calendar! Missing a payment can lead to extra fees and a cycle of debt that's hard to escape. The best strategy is to have a solid plan for repayment the moment you take out the loan.
